Entails

/ɪnˈteɪlz/ verb

Involves or necessitates as a natural or logical consequence; requires as a necessary part or result. Also refers to a legal restriction limiting inheritance of property to specific heirs.

From Old French 'entailler' meaning 'to cut into', from 'en-' (into) and 'tailler' (to cut). The logical sense developed from the legal meaning of 'cutting' or limiting inheritance rights.
